Baltimore Customs and Border Protection Arrests Violent Man

BALTIMORE, Md. (CBS) - The Baltimore Customs and Border Protection arrested a man Tuesday who was wanted by the Prince George's County Police for second degree assault as he was trying to flee the country.

Police say Davanon Anthony Hopkins, of Hyattsville, Md., a Jamaican citizen, was scheduled to leave the country for Jamaica when he was stopped by CBP officers.

After verifying his identity, Hopkins was arrested and turned over to Maryland Transportation Authority Police for extradition.

The CBP has placed an immigration detainer on Hopkins, who is a U.S. permanent resident, ensuring that he is returned to CBP before attempting to leave the country in the future.
